“…Ribosome profiling sequences mRNA transcripts that are associated with ribosomes and thus can be used to identify transcribed genes that are likely to be translated to proteins (Ingolia et al, 2009). Therefore, ribosome profiling serves as an orthogonal approach (Clauwaert et al, 2019;Ndah et al, 2017) and validation strategy (Durrant and Bhatt, 2021) to aid in small-gene prediction. We used Meta-Ribo-Seq datasets generated from four metagenomic assemblies of human fecal microbiome samples Fremin et al, , 2021 that were independent of the IMG/VR (Roux et al, 2021) and the HMP2 (Lloyd-Price et al, 2017) datasets, representing a non-overlapping validation dataset for the two resources.…”
